List of Grey's Anatomy Characters - Main Characters

Main Characters

The following is a list of all current and previous main characters who have featured in Grey's Anatomy. The characters are listed in alphabetical order.

Name Actor/actress Starring seasons Recurring seasons Occupation at Seattle Grace Job Title
Theodora 'Teddy' Altman Kim Raver 6, 7, 8 6 Attending Cardiothoracic Surgeon M.D., F.A.C.S.
Dr. Altman took over the job as Chief of Cardiothoracic Surgery at Seattle Grace in season six. She previously served in Iraq with Owen Hunt. Although a skilled surgeon, her teaching methods might appear somewhat unorthodox. Her arrival at Seattle Grace, followed by her profession of love to Owen has caused some friction between Owen and his girlfriend, Cristina Yang. Teddy marries a patient at the hospital named Henry to get him insurance, but she eventually falls in love with him. Over time, Teddy forms a friendship with Cristina, but her friendship with Owen ends when she feels he puts the hospital before her. Owen and her eventually make up in the season finale. Owen finds out she was offered a job at the Army Medical Command, but turned it down because she wanted to be there for Owen, if he and Cristina were to separate. He ultimately fires her, and tells her that he will be okay.
Jackson Avery Jesse Williams 7, 8, 9 6 Plastic Surgical Fellow M.D.
First introduced as a surgical resident from Mercy West Hospital, he is also called "pretty boy," especially by Cristina Yang. He is a grandson of the famous surgeon, Dr. Harper Avery, and is focusing on plastics. He develops a crush on Cristina, and while inebriated he kisses her at a party, but Cristina breaks the kiss. In the 6th season finale, he is told by Dr. Shepherd that there is a lockdown in the hospital and is later left by Dr. Hunt and Dr. Altman in the OR with 2 nurses and 1 anesthesiologist. He is the one who decides that Yang should operate on Shepherd in order to save him. When Mr. Clark (the shooter) takes the OR hostage, he disconnects Shepherd in order to make everyone believe that he is dead until Mr. Clark leaves the room. It is also revealed later in season 7 that Avery suffers from traumatic nightmares. Avery also has a complicated relationship with Lexie Grey, which is a recurring plot point on the show. Though he was offered a position as surgical fellow at Tulane Medical Center, Avery decided to stay in Seattle. At the end of season 8 he starts having sex with his best friend April Kepner, but their relationship is complicated.
Miranda Bailey Chandra Wilson 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9 Attending General Surgeon M.D.
An attending general surgeon at Seattle Grace hospital, Miranda Bailey initially gave a cold, domineering impression, earning her the nickname "The Nazi". However, her attitude has since softened, and she has developed a maternal role towards the residents in the hospital. She has undergone a divorce which led her to turn down a fellowship in pediatric surgery. She is dating an anesthesiologist, Ben Warren, with whom she is now engaged to. In season 9, it is revealed that Bailey now has the nickname BCB (Booty Call Bailey), due to her increasing love with Ben Warren.
Preston Burke Isaiah Washington 1, 2, 3 Attending Cardiothoracic Surgeon M.D., F.A.C.S.
Preston Burke was the former Chief of Cardiothoracic Surgery. He began a romantic relationship with Cristina Yang, which came under strain when Burke was shot and his right hand's nerve supply was disrupted. With his career threatened he had Yang perform some of his surgeries, a situation which resolved when Derek Shepherd repaired Burke's nerve supply. Burke and Yang continued their relationship which ultimately ended on their wedding day, when he left her at the altar. Burke graduated at the top of his class from the Johns Hopkins University School of Medicine. In season four, Burke was metioned to get the Harper Avery Award.
Alexandra 'Lexie' Grey Chyler Leigh 4, 5, 6, 7, 8 3 Surgical Resident M.D.
Resident and half-sister of Meredith Grey, Lexie attended Harvard Medical School. She has had relationships with Mark, Alex, and Jackson. Known for her photographic memory, she has earned the nickname Lexipedia. Initially she had a distant, contentious relationship with Meredith, but they have since grown closer. She is often called "Little Grey" by other doctors on staff. In the season 8 finale, she dies from the consequences of a plane crash that took place at the end of the penultimate episode.
Meredith Grey Ellen Pompeo 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9 Attending General Surgeon M.D.
Resident Meredith Grey is the central protagonist of the show, and narrator of the majority of episodes. She began the series as an intern and has since progressed along her career path. Her character is defined by her romantic relationships as well as the lingering effects her mother's affair with Richard Webber has had on her life. She is best friends with Cristina Yang and following a long romance, she has married neurosurgeon Derek Shepherd, and they adopted a baby named Zola. In season 9, Meredith is an attending general surgeon and has earned the nickname "Medusa" by her interns and residents and as a result of the plane crash cannot find the strength to fly, like Cristina, which makes it so they talk via Skype.
Erica Hahn Brooke Smith 4, 5 2, 3 Attending Cardiothoracic Surgeon M.D., F.A.C.S.
Following Preston Burke's departure, Erica Hahn took his position as Chief of Cardiothoracic Surgery at Seattle Grace. Her brusque, somewhat harsh personality was tempered by Callie Torres, with whom she began a relationship. Her time at Seattle Grace ended abruptly, however, when she became discontent with Izzie Stevens, and the lack of disciplinary action following the Denny Duquette incident. Dr. Hahn attended the Johns Hopkins University School of Medicine, where she was in the same class as Dr. Burke.
Owen Hunt Kevin McKidd 5, 6, 7, 8, 9 5 Attending Trauma Surgeon Chief of Surgery, Chief of Trauma Surgery
Owen Hunt, Chief of Trauma Surgery, is the husband of Cristina Yang. Suffering from Post-Traumatic Stress Disorder, he has struggled with the horrors he experienced whilst serving with the army in Iraq. He invited former colleague Teddy Altman to work alongside him at Seattle Grace, a decision which caused some friction between himself and Cristina. In the season 7 premiere he marries Cristina. Later, he is also offered the position by Richard Webber to choose the next chief resident at Seattle Grace. He was later promoted to Chief of Surgery after Webber resigned. He and Cristina are currently experiencing marital problems due to his infidelity in season 8.
Alex Karev Justin Chambers 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9 Pediatric Surgical Fellow M.D.
Hard-headed and often discourteous Resident, Alex Karev has had a series of unfortunate relationships throughout his life beginning with his mother. At an early age he had to become her defender from an abusive father and later her caretaker. While working as a doctor he was involved with a patient, Ava, but her mental instability strained their relationship and Alex once again adopted a caretaker role before Ava's admission to a psychiatric hospital. He subsequently embarked on a relationship with Izzie Stevens, and they wed, but Izzie asked for a divorce following her dismissal from Seattle Grace. In the season 8 finale, he was meant to fly with other surgeons to perform a procedure at Boise Memorial. After disclosing his intention to do his Pediatric Surgical Fellowship at the Johns Hopkins Hospital to Dr. Robbins she, in anger, replaces him. In the season 9 premiere he is supposed to be leaving Seattle Grace, having deferred his fellowship in the aftermath of the plane crash. Upon realizing the drastic changes that will happen in both his and Dr. Robbin's absence and due to the hiring of a new Chief of Pediatric Surgery, he changes his mind and stays on at Seattle Grace.
April Kepner Sarah Drew 7, 8, 9 6 Attending General Surgeon M.D.
First introduced as a surgical resident from Mercy West Hospital, she was fired in Episode 6.06 by Chief Webber, but later rehired by Dr. Shepherd in Episode 6.13 due to his believing her dismissal was unfair. Later it is revealed that she has a crush on Dr. Shepherd in Episode 6.19. In the season six finale, she informs him that her best friend Dr. Reed Adamson has been shot and killed. She later runs into Mr. Clark (the shooter) when Shepherd was shot. Clark lets her go when she emotionally tells him everything about her life. In the third episode of season 7, April reveals that she is a virgin. In the season 7 finale, April becomes Chief Resident. She fails to pass her Medical Boards and is later fired from Seattle Grace, but is asked back in season 9.
Addison Montgomery Kate Walsh 2, 3 1, 2 Attending Neonatal Surgeon/Obstetrician-Gynecologist M.D., F.A.C.S.
Former Chief of OB/GYN and Neonatal Surgery, and the ex-wife of Derek Shepherd, Addison transferred to Seattle Grace, seeking reconciliation with Derek. After achieving a degree of understanding with Derek and realizing that he was in love with Meredith Grey, Addison left Seattle Grace. The character is now the protagonist of ABC series Private Practice and continues to make guest appearances on Grey's Anatomy.
George O'Malley T.R. Knight 1, 2, 3, 4, 5 Surgical Resident M.D.
George O'Malley had a less aggressive personality compared with his fellow residents. He once had an infatuation with Meredith Grey which ended when they slept together, and halfway through Meredith began to cry, humiliating George. He also had a strong friendship with Izzie Stevens and later Lexie Grey. He was once married to Callie Torres, but their marriage came to an end when George slept with Izzie. George and Izzie tried a relationship but decided to remain as friends when they realized their relationship lacked chemistry. Inspired by Dr. Hunt's experiences, George decided to leave Seattle Grace and enlist in the Army. Tragically, on his way to tell his mother about joining the Army, George died from injuries sustained from rescuing a girl from being hit by a bus, sacrificing himself instead.
Arizona Robbins Jessica Capshaw 6, 7, 8, 9 5 Attending Pediatric Surgeon Chief of Pediatric Surgery
Arizona Robbins, pediatric surgery attending, has a cheery disposition but gets upset when challenging authority. She has embarked on a relationship with Callie Torres. She comes from a military family and graduated from the Johns Hopkins University School of Medicine. She has been revealed to harbor great emotional intelligence; her insight and advice have been used to defuse several situations, such as Callie's dispute with her father. In season 7, she wins a prestigious award, and she and Callie plan to move to Malawi, Africa and work there. However, she breaks up with Callie and leaves her at the airport. They reconcile soon after, and ultimately get married. In the season 9 premiere she has lost one of her legs due to injuries sustained during a plane crash at the end of season 8.
Derek Shepherd Patrick Dempsey 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9 Attending Neurosurgeon Chief of Neurosurgery
As Chief of Neurosurgery, Derek Shepherd earned the nickname McDreamy by the female staff of Seattle Grace. The lead male character, he is known for his complicated love-life. Initially he moved to Seattle from New York to get away from his adulterous ex-wife Addison Montgomery whom he discovered was having an affair with his best friend, Mark Sloan. He subsequently began a long romance with Meredith Grey which resulted in their marriage. Recently he had a somewhat antagonistic relationship with Richard Webber whom he believed wasn't governing the hospital appropriately. He took over as the Chief of Surgery after going to the hospital board about Chief Webber's drinking problem, but resigned after nearly dying from being shot because he thought being chief wasn't his place. He and Meredith adopted an orphan from Africa in season 7, named Zola. Surviving the plane crash in the Season 8 finale, the season 9 premiere shows that he's recovering from his injured hand but not soon enough. His hand goes numb while trying to grip one of the instruments before surgery.
Mark Sloan Eric Dane 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8 2, 3, 9* Attending Plastic Surgeon Chief of Plastic Surgery
Mark Sloan, Chief of Plastic Surgery, attended Columbia University College of Physicians and Surgeons. He has a playboy personality that nearly jeopardized his friendship with Derek by having an affair with his wife, Addison Montgomery. He knew both Derek and Addison Shepherd from when all three lived in New York. Derek and Mark managed to resolve their issues and reaffirm their friendship. He has been given the nickname "McSteamy" by Meredith and her friends. Sloan had a relationship with Lexie Grey which ended due to strain when Mark's 18 year old daughter from a one night stand appeared at the hospital and subsequently moved in with them. The girl's mother had named her Sloane and never told Mark about her. She arrived in Seattle unannounced, and Mark found out she was pregnant. Mark wanted to keep the baby but Sloane decided to give it up for adoption. After that, Mark and Lexie retake their relationship, but it ended when Mark got Callie Torres pregnant, and Lexie started dating Jackson Avery. He died in the Season 9 premiere due to injuries sustained in the plane crash.
Isobel 'Izzie' Stevens Katherine Heigl 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6 Surgical Resident M.D.
Growing up in a trailer park and putting her newborn daughter up for adoption at age 16, Izzie managed to progress along medical school by paying her bills through modeling. She put her career as doctor on the line in a risky bid to get her lover Denny Duquette a new heart by cutting his LVAD wires. Denny subsequently died but Izzie managed to keep her job. Izzie began a relationship with Alex Karev, but their relationship came under strain when she was diagnosed with metastatic melanoma. She survived the condition following treatment with Interleukin 2 but after restarting work she accidentally induced hyperkalemia in a patient listed for renal transplant. Subsequently she lost her job, and left Seattle. She and Alex are now divorced.
Calliope 'Callie' Torres Sara Ramirez 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9 2 Attending Orthopedic Surgeon M.D.
Callie is an orthopedic surgeon. She was introduced as an orthopedic surgical resident, and then promoted to an attending. She was once married to George O'Malley, but divorced after he developed feelings for Izzie Stevens. Later, she had an affair with Erica Hahn which was cut short by Hahn's departure from Seattle Grace. She was in a happy relationship with Arizona Robbins but they broke up because Arizona did not want to have kids. However at the end of the 6th season, after doing a surgery on a small girl while a shooter is loose in the hospital, Callie tells Arizona in a round about way that she loves her and the two end up getting back together and decide that they are going to have children. In season 7, Callie was going to move to Africa with Arizona, but Arizona breaks up with her and then leaves her at the airport in Seattle. Callie ends up sleeping with Mark again and gets pregnant. Arizona later returns for Callie and they get back together. On episode 7.18 Callie gets horribly injured in a car crash with Arizona. Addison, delivers her baby at 23 weeks, which then survives. Later Dr. Bailey marries Arizona and Callie. The season 9 premiere shows a strained relationship between Callie and Arizona with Mark dying and Arizona having one leg amputated, by Alex Karev.
Richard Webber James Pickens, Jr. 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9 Attending General Surgeon M.D., F.A.C.S.
Authority figure and former Chief of Surgery at Seattle Grace, Richard has had a difficult past characterized by affairs and alcoholism. His relationship with Meredith Grey is at times volatile because he had an affair with her mother. Recently Richard has struggled with managing the finances of Seattle Grace and has merged the hospital with Mercy West Hospital. The merger has caused him much stress, strained his relationship with Derek Shepherd and ultimately contributed to the collapse of his sobriety. He stepped down as Chief of Surgery in season 8. In the season 9 premiere, it was Dr. Webber that pulled the plug on Mark Sloan.
Cristina Yang Sandra Oh 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9 Cardiothoracic Surgical Fellow M.D., Ph.D.
Cristina Yang attained a Ph.D. in Biochemistry from the University of California, Berkeley and an M.D. from Stanford University School of Medicine. A skilled resident, Cristina Yang has an indomitable passion for cardiothoracic surgery, and is almost ruthless in pursuit of her desired specialty. She is best friends with Meredith Grey, and has previously been in a relationship with Preston Burke, which ended suddenly when he left Cristina on their wedding day. Since then she has entered into a relationship with Owen Hunt, whom she marries in season 7. As of the season 9 premiere, she is participating in a cardiothoracic surgical fellowship program at the Mayo Clinic in Rochester, Minnesota, and like Meredith, unable to board a plane.
  • * Although only guest-starring in the first two episodes of the ninth season, Eric Dane was still billed as a member of the main cast in them.
